Live at Midokaikan Hall, Osaka, Japan September 19th 1986

Roy Buchanan - guitar, vocals
Jeff Ganz - bass, vocals
Ray Marchica- Drums

This two-disc set features a superb stereo soundboard recording of Roy Buchanan's live performance at the Mido Kaikan in Osaka on September 19th, 1986, from his second tour of Japan in 1986.

Buchanan showcases his exceptional guitar playing, skillfully manipulating tone and volume knobs to freely change the tone of his guitar using both pick and fingerstyle techniques.

The set includes 15 tracks, including Cream's "Sunshine Of Your Love" and Jimi Hendrix's "Hey Joe / Foxy Lady Purple Haze."

Enjoy this superb sound recording of Roy Buchanan's 1986 Osaka performance, an artist who influenced many leading rock artists such as Eric Clapton, Jeff Beck, Steve Howe, Gary Moore, and David Gilmour.
